Calais City Council orders 5 percent spending cut to fight deficit

Photo by Andrea Walton.The Calais City Council lamented a “tight budget” at a Thursday workshop, warning that closing the deficit could trigger cuts to city services. To offset an accrued $544,000 tax bill from Washington County, council members ordered department heads to shave 5 percent from their proposals for the upcoming fiscal year.
